Central York grad Paul Kuhn earns All-America nod at Juniata
Juniata sophomore Paul Kuhn, a Central York graduate, was named to the American Volleyball Coaches Association Division III All-America Team. Kuhn, a 6-7 outside hitter, was named to the second team. Kuhn is the Eagles’ offensive leader with the highest … Continue reading

Central York’s Brad Livingston to be inducted in PVCA Hall of Fame
Central York coach Brad Livingston will be inducted into the Pennsylvania Volleyball Coaches Association Hall of Fame on Saturday, Dec. 1.
